VBReFormer Professional Edition 5.4.102 is a specialized recovery and design editing tool designed for legacy Visual Basic 5 and 6 applications. It is primarily used by developers to recover lost source code or modify the user interface of compiled binaries without needing the original project files. Core Capabilities
Design Recovery: Reconstructs the visual design of forms and controls, including properties, values, and references to external ActiveX libraries.
GUI Edition: Allows for direct editing of the static design properties of a VB6 binary (e.g., changing labels or colors).
Disassembly & Decompilation: Converts binary code into a readable format. It can disassemble functions and methods in forms, classes, and modules, specifically for applications compiled in Native Code.
Post-Build Compilation: Features technology that re-builds the binary code after design changes, ensuring the modifications are integrated without size limitations. How to Use VBReFormer
Load the Executable: Open the software and select the Visual Basic 5 or 6 .exe file you wish to analyze.
Analyze the Design: Use the design editor to view the application's forms. You can modify properties (like captions or positions) directly within the tool.
Recover Code: Use the decompiler/disassembler tab to view the logic. While it may not recover 100% of the original source code, it provides the essential information needed to rewrite the application.
Save Changes: If you have edited the UI, use the "Save" feature to apply these changes back to the binary. Key Specifications Software Version: 5.4.102 (Professional Edition). Compatibility: Optimized for Windows 7 and later.
Target Format: Visual Basic 5.0 and 6.0 binaries (.exe, .dll, .ocx).
Portable Nature: The "Portable" version allows the tool to run from a USB drive or external folder without a full system installation, making it useful for forensic or maintenance tasks on different machines. Important Considerations
Legal Note: Decompiling software may be restricted by end-user license agreements (EULA) or local copyright laws unless you own the original code.
P-Code vs. Native: VBReFormer is particularly effective for Native Code disassembly, whereas other tools might focus on P-Code (an intermediate language).
Recovery Limits: While it recovers the UI perfectly, the recovered logic is often provided as assembly or partial code, which requires manual effort to fully convert back into standard Visual Basic.

VBReformer Professional Edition is a specialized software suite designed for the recovery, decompilation, and modification of legacy Visual Basic 5.0 and 6.0 applications. It serves as a critical bridge for developers who need to maintain, update, or migrate older software for which the original source code has been lost. Core Functionalities
The suite operates as three tools in one: a decompiler, a disassembler, and a design editor.
Native Decompilation: Unlike many tools that focus on P-Code (Pseudo-Code), VBReformer is optimized for applications compiled in Native Code mode, which accounts for approximately 80% of classic Visual Basic software. It attempts to reconstruct the most complete Visual Basic source code possible from the binary.
Compiled UI Editor: A unique feature is its ability to edit the User Interface (UI) of a compiled application "on the fly" without needing to recompile the executable. It can recover and extract meta-information such as forms, user controls, and pictures directly into a new Visual Basic project.
Disassembly: For deeper analysis, it disassembles functions and methods within classes and modules, allowing professionals to examine the logic at a low level. Key Features of Professional Edition
The Professional Edition (specifically mentioned in versions like 5.4) provides advanced capabilities over the free version:
Unlimited UI Modification: It allows users to change or import design information (text, pictures) with no size limitations.
Hidden Property Activation: It can unlock and modify hidden object properties that were set to default values during original compilation.
Native Engine: It uses a proprietary decompilation engine to convert Native code to readable Visual Basic code to the fullest extent possible.
